A water pipe convenient to install
By welding a convex ring to the outside of the water pipe and cooperating with the mounting bracket, the rotation of the pipe is restricted by the locking component, which solves the problem of shaking during water pipe installation and improves the stability and sealing of the installation.

Technical Field
[0001] This utility model relates to the field of water pipe technology, and in particular to a water pipe that is easy to install. Background Technology
[0002] Water pipes are pipes that supply water and are an important component of water conservancy projects. Water pipes can be classified into three types: the first type is metal pipes, such as hot-dip galvanized cast iron pipes with internal plastic lining, copper pipes, and stainless steel pipes. The second type is plastic-coated metal pipes, such as steel-plastic composite pipes and aluminum-plastic composite pipes.
[0003] However, existing patents have the following drawbacks:
[0004] (1) Most existing utility models of water pipes will install brackets on the wall in advance during pipe installation, and then lock the pipes with the brackets after the pipes are connected to prevent them from rotating. However, since the brackets cannot properly limit the pipes when they are not locked, the pipes are prone to shaking when they are connected, resulting in the axis being skewed, the connection thread slipping or jamming, which affects the sealing of the water pipe connection and makes it inconvenient to install the water pipes. Utility Model Content
[0005] The technical problem to be solved by this utility model is to overcome the above-mentioned technical defects and provide a water pipe that can limit the stable rotation of the pipe and can quickly lock the pipe for easy installation.
[0006] To solve the above problems, the technical solution of this utility model is as follows: a water pipe that is easy to install, including a pipe and a mounting bracket. The pipe has a butt joint at both ends, the mounting bracket is fitted on the outside of the pipe, the bottom of the mounting bracket has an installation hole, and the outer sides of both ends of the pipe are fixedly connected with a convex ring at a certain distance from the butt joint. The inner side of the mounting bracket is rotatably connected to the outer side of the convex ring, and the bottom of the mounting bracket is provided with a locking component to prevent the pipe from rotating.
[0007] Furthermore, the locking assembly includes a locking tooth, a lead screw, and an adjusting ring. A groove is provided on the top inner side of the mounting bracket, the locking tooth is slidably connected to the inner side of the groove, an adjusting groove is provided at the bottom end of the groove, the lead screw is fixedly connected to the inner side of the adjusting groove, and the adjusting ring is threadedly connected to the outer side of the lead screw.
[0008] Furthermore, a connecting shaft is fixedly connected to the bottom end of the tooth, and a through hole is provided between the slide groove and the adjustment groove, with the connecting shaft slidably connected to the through hole.
[0009] Furthermore, an annular groove is provided on the outer side of the convex ring, and the groove meshes with the teeth of the locking teeth.
[0010] Furthermore, the top of the adjusting ring has an annular groove, and a connecting ring is nested inside the groove. The connecting ring is rotatably connected to the groove, and the top of the connecting ring is fixedly connected to the bottom of the connecting shaft.
[0011] The advantages of this invention compared to existing technologies are as follows:
[0012] (1) The present invention provides a water pipe that is easy to install. A convex ring is pre-welded to the outside of the pipe, and a rotating mounting bracket is directly set on the outside of the convex ring. When the pipe is connected, the bracket will mount the pipe on the wall. Since the mounting bracket restricts the convex ring, the pipe can be freely selected while maintaining the stability of the axis, which is convenient for pipe connection. After connection, a locking component can be used to lock the pipe and prevent the pipe from rotating afterward. The operation is quick and simple, and the water pipe is easy to install. [0020] like Figures 1 to 3As shown, an easy-to-install water pipe includes a pipe and a mounting bracket. The pipe has connectors at both ends, the mounting bracket is fitted over the outside of the pipe, and the bottom of the mounting bracket has an installation hole. The pipe has a convex ring fixedly connected to the outside of both ends at a certain distance from the connector. This length is calculated based on the overall length of the pipe, stress, and deflection. The inside of the mounting bracket is rotatably connected to the outside of the convex ring, and the bottom of the mounting bracket is provided with a locking component to prevent the pipe from rotating.
[0021] The locking assembly includes a locking tooth, a lead screw, and an adjusting ring. A groove is formed on the top inner side of the mounting bracket, and the locking tooth is slidably connected to the inner side of the groove. An adjusting groove is formed at the bottom end of the groove, and the lead screw is fixedly connected to the inner side of the adjusting groove. The adjusting ring is threadedly connected to the outer side of the lead screw. A connecting shaft is fixedly connected to the bottom end of the locking tooth. A through hole is formed between the groove and the adjusting groove, and the connecting shaft is slidably connected to the through hole. An annular toothed groove is formed on the outer side of the convex ring, and the toothed groove meshes with the teeth of the locking tooth. An annular groove is formed at the top end of the adjusting ring, and a connecting ring is nested inside the groove. The connecting ring is rotatably connected to the groove, and the top end of the connecting ring is fixedly connected to the bottom end of the connecting shaft.
[0022] In practical use, depending on the location where the pipe needs to be installed, the mounting bracket is pre-fixed to the wall, ceiling or floor with bolts. At this time, the pipe is mounted on the bracket, and the pipe is restricted from rotating by the outer welded convex ring, so that the pipe can rotate stably and connect with the connecting pipe or sealing sleeve. After the connection is completed, the position of the pipe is adjusted, and the pipe can be locked.
[0023] At this point, simply rotate the adjusting ring. The adjusting ring is threaded onto the lead screw. As it rotates, it moves evenly outside the lead screw. This rotation, through the internally nested rotating connecting ring, pushes the connecting shaft to slide within the insertion hole. The connecting shaft then pushes the retaining teeth towards the convex ring. The convex ring has an annular toothed groove on its outer side, which engages with the retaining teeth. As the retaining teeth approach the groove, their teeth extend into it, locking the pipe and preventing rotation. Due to the self-locking property of the lead screw, the adjusting ring's position is fixed, preventing the retaining teeth from disengaging from the groove.
